1. Web3 Airdrop Operational Mechanism and College Student Participation Motivation#
Q: What is the essence of blockchain airdrops? What is the economic logic behind college students' participation?
A:
The essence of airdrops is the token distribution strategy of blockchain projects, which filters real users through preset conditions (social interactions/on-chain interactions). The motivations for college students to participate include:
- Marginal Cost Advantage: Single task time cost of 5-15 minutes, suitable for fragmented time management
- Leverage Effect: Zero capital startup, Gas fee leverage to unlock potential returns (historical case: Uniswap airdrop average $1200+)
- Cognitive Arbitrage: Capturing early project value dividends by utilizing information asymmetry

5. Building Airdrop Security Defense System#
Q: How to establish a multi-dimensional defense mechanism to cope with on-chain risks?
A:
Risk Matrix:
- Technical Risks: Contract vulnerabilities, private key leaks
- Operational Risks: Phishing attacks, excessive authorizations
- Compliance Risks: Misuse of KYC information
Protection Strategies: - Use "cold-hot wallet separation architecture" (Ledger cold storage + Trezor hot transactions)
- Deploy "smart contract firewall" (Revoke.cash for regular checks)
- Implement "least privilege principle" (reset authorization limits for each interaction)
